CityU's Language Information Sciences Research Centre and the Chinese Academy of Social Sciences apply advanced information technology to produce a new Language Atlas of China that displays and explains the complex distribution of languages and dialects inside and outside China.
In mid-May 2004, Dr Joseph Fong, Associate Professor of the Department of Computer Science, obtained sponsorship nearing HK$1 million from the Hong Kong Government's Innovation and Technology Fund and the industrial sector in support of his project to develop a software tool that advances database processing onto the Internet superhighway. His research has significant application value to e-Government and e-Commerce.

生物學家、城大生物及化學系副教授鄭淑嫻博士在其水產毒理學研究的基礎上,發展出一套中藥測試系統。鄭博士利用斑馬魚來識別可以刺激或抑制新血管生成的草藥。這個名為“利用硬骨魚胚胎作為血管形成調節活動的監察劑”的項目,獲得香港創新及科技基金(ITF)中的創新及科技支援計畫250萬港元資助。
An international symposium promoting the exchange of ideas on the economic, political social and cultural developments arising from the changing relations between China and Southeast Asia was held at CityU March 24-25. "China and Southeast Asia: Challenges, opportunities and the reconstruction of Southeast Asian Chinese ethnic capital" was co-organized by CityU's Southeast Asia Research Centre (SEARC) and the Center for Southeast Asian Studies (CSAS) at Xiamen University.
